Flowerpots everywhere

The first idea, which we are all familiar with, is to buy pots with different flowers and aromatic herbs. There is no excuse for this. Even if you think there is no room for floral designs in your home, you will always find a place for them.

You can place the plants on a shelf, a small table or even hanging from the ceiling or attached to a wall. If you are looking forward to having a tree, choose a bonsai.

 

 

 

A balcony, terrace or window as the lungs of the house


If you have a terrace, fill it with flowers of all colours. In pots, in a vertical garden... You can also add a water fountain. If you don't have a balcony, choose a window to make it your little lung.

A home garden

Nowadays, home gardens have become fashionable, and it is a hobby that, in addition to helping relaxation, provides other benefits, such as a few vegetables or aromatic herbs to perfume your home and season your meals.

 

 

Among the most modern gardens you have the smart grow, an intelligent system with which you get healthy, colourful and tasty plants for the whole year.

Nature's own elements

If you want to bring nature into your home, don't just go for the typical flower pots. You can also opt for some wooden logs, some pine cones, some stones or some dried leaves or flowers. With them you can make beautiful compositions to place in different areas of the house.

Benefits of green spaces in your home

Nature brings you a lot of health benefits, both physical and mental. It gives you cleaner, purer air that is good for your lungs and your overall health. It also helps you to eliminate stress, so you will sleep better and feel more relaxed and happy.

In addition, plants can help you fight the heat effectively when the summer temperatures get hotter and without the need for air conditioning or other artificial solutions.
